圆柱体膨胀

可以重复进行相同的练习,以对圆柱体的膨胀而非收缩进行建模。在壁面边界处指定位移而非方格速度。

  1. 选择文件 > 另存为,然后使用文件名 expansion.sim 保存模拟。
  2. 根据局部圆柱坐标系为圆柱体壁面位移创建场函数:
    1. 右键单击自动化 > 场函数,然后选择新建 > 矢量
    2. 将矢量场函数重命名为圆柱体壁面位移
    3. 选择圆柱体壁面位移节点,然后设置下列属性:
      属性 设置
      函数名 CylinderWallDisplacement
      量纲 长度
      定义 [(($$Position("Cylindrical 1")[2] < 2) ? 0.00625*$$Position("Cylindrical 1")[2] : 0.00625*(4-$$Position("Cylindrical 1")[2])), 0, 0]
必须修改圆柱体壁面上的变形条件才能使用新的场函数。
  1. 编辑区域 > 流体 > 边界 > 壁面节点,并设置下列属性:
    节点 属性 设置
    物理条件
    变形指定 指定 位移
    变形位移指定 指定 坐标偏移
    物理值
    坐标偏移 方法 场函数
    矢量函数 圆柱体壁面位移
    坐标系 基准->圆柱 1
此时将完成膨胀模拟所需的更改。
  1. 从菜单栏中选择求解 > 清除求解,然后单击确定
  2. 如前,继续使用求解 > 运行选项或工具栏上的 运行)按钮初始化并运行模拟。
在此次模拟结束时:
  1. 单击图形窗口顶部的圆柱体壁面选项卡。
  2. 使用鼠标按键放大并定位零部件,以获取和以下所示类似的视图。